Friendly, leashed, non-service animals are welcome on the upper deck which is attached to the pizzeria. That is open at 4:30pm daily, and at noon on Saturday & Sunday. While there is no direct food service, dogs are also welcome in the courtyard. You can sit out there with your pet, and on weekends you can also get tacos and beer from the Lovell Taproom.
Sure, sit on. The patio.
Thanks! Your answer is awaiting moderation.